随着互联网技术的不断发展,前端框架在提高网页性能和开发效率方面发挥着越来越重要的作用。轻量级前端框架因其简洁、高效的特点,成为了许多开发者的首选。本文将深入探讨轻量级前端框架的优势,并介绍如何利用这些框架让网页速度更快,开发更轻松。
一、轻量级前端框架的定义
轻量级前端框架指的是那些体积小、功能单一、易于上手的前端开发工具。与重量级框架相比,轻量级框架在保证基本功能的同时,尽量减少冗余代码,从而降低页面加载时间和内存占用。
二、轻量级前端框架的优势
- 加载速度快:轻量级框架通常体积较小,能够快速加载,提高用户体验。
- 降低内存占用:由于代码简洁,轻量级框架能够有效降低内存占用,提高页面性能。
- 易于学习和使用:轻量级框架通常具有简单易学的特点,方便开发者快速上手。
- 灵活性和可扩展性:轻量级框架提供丰富的API和插件,满足不同开发需求。
三、常见的轻量级前端框架
- jQuery:jQuery 是一款非常流行的轻量级 JavaScript 库,简化了 HTML 文档遍历、事件处理、动画和 Ajax 操作。
- Bootstrap:Bootstrap 是一款响应式前端框架,提供了一套丰富的 UI 组件和样式,帮助开发者快速构建美观、响应式的网页。
- Svelte:Svelte 是一种前端框架,它将组件逻辑和模板分离,减少了浏览器的渲染负担。
- Vue.js:Vue.js 是一款渐进式 JavaScript 框架,具有简洁、易用、高性能等特点。
四、如何利用轻量级前端框架提升网页速度
- 选择合适的框架:根据项目需求和团队熟悉程度,选择合适的轻量级框架。
- 优化代码:使用框架提供的优化技巧,如代码压缩、合并、懒加载等,减少页面加载时间。
- 利用缓存:合理使用浏览器缓存,提高页面加载速度。
- 图片优化:对图片进行压缩和优化,减少图片体积,提高加载速度。
五、如何利用轻量级前端框架提升开发效率
- 组件化开发:利用框架提供的组件,提高开发效率。
- 模块化开发:将代码拆分成模块,便于管理和维护。
- 代码复用:利用框架提供的代码复用机制,提高开发效率。
- 学习曲线:选择易于学习的轻量级框架,降低学习成本。
六、总结
轻量级前端框架在提高网页速度和开发效率方面具有显著优势。通过选择合适的框架、优化代码、利用缓存和组件化开发,我们可以充分利用轻量级前端框架的优势,打造高性能、易开发的网页。
